Heart of the Rockies

(Edited)

Here are the Canadian Rockies, as seen from Canmore, Alberta. Although not located inside Banff Park, Canmore is home to many permanent workers, that support the tourism industry in the area. So you might say it is the heartbeat that keeps tourism going. Without the hospitality staff, guides, professionals and other integral people, the Canadian Parks machine would come to a grinding halt.
